Beginner

Beginner group lessons are designed for youth and adults who are entirely new to skiing or snowboarding. These lessons focus on introducing you to the fundamentals of the sport, including basic movements, balance, and control. The goal of the beginner lessons is to help you feel comfortable on the snow and confident in your ability to perform basic maneuvers. The lessons are taught by experienced instructors who are able to provide personalised coaching and feedback to each participant.

  • Adults & Youth over 5 years old
  • Maximum 10 people per lesson
  • Skiing & Snowboarding Beginners level only (Level 1)

 

In Level 1 ski you will learn:

  • Safely carry equipment and know how it works
  • Put on and take off skis
  • Side step and/or duck walk and/or skate
  • Ski down short hill balancing on both skis
  • Practice making a wedge, making it bigger to stop
  • Ride the Beginner lift and get on and off safely
  • Get up independently if fallen over
  • Turn on gentle terrain

 

In Level 1 snowboard you will learn:

  • Safely carry equipment and know how it works
  • Basic stance and the four ways to move
  • Skate, glide, climb with the front foot strapped in
  • One-foot straight run and a J-turn left and right
  • Strap in both feet and stand up independently
  • Heel side control, side slip and floating leaf
  • Toe side control, side slip and floating leaf
  • Ride the Beginner lift and get on and off safely

Beginner+

Beginner+ group lessons are designed for youth and adults who have completed the beginner lessons and are ready to progress to the next level. These lessons focus on building on the skills learned in the beginner lessons, with a particular emphasis on developing turning and stopping techniques. Participants will also learn how to navigate different types of terrain and conditions. The lessons are taught by experienced instructors who are able to provide personalized coaching and feedback to each participant.

  • Adults & Youth > 5 yrs.
  • Maximum 10 people per lesson
  • Skiing only
  • Beginners level only (Level 2)

 

In level 2 ski you will learn:

  • Ski maintaining good balance
  • Practice gliding in a wedge
  • Change direction by pointing the wedge left and right
  • Control speed with big S shape turns
  • Use turns to stop
  • Hop whilst skiing
  • Link turns on green runs
  • Know how to ride the pommer lift and get on and off
  • Know how to ride chairlift and get on and off (depending on group ability)

Easy Rider

Easy Rider lessons are designed for youth and adults who have completed the Beginner+ lessons and are ready to progress to the next level. These lessons focus on developing the skills needed to tackle more challenging terrain, including steeper slopes and varied snow conditions.

Participants will learn how to adjust their technique to different situations and develop greater control and confidence on the snow. Experience on chairlift is required (Our chairlift access to slopes differs from other resorts, please enquire with snowsport@skiporters.co.nz if you’re unsure about your abilities). The lessons are taught by experienced instructors who are able to provide personalized coaching and feedback to each participant.

1.5 hours

Prerequisite:

  • Must be able to ride a chairlift
  • Maximum 5 people per group
  • Skiing only
  • Intermediate Level only (Level 3)

 

In level 3 ski you will learn:

  • Balance on outside ski when turning
  • Steer skis parallel at the end of turns
  • Control speed by making round turns on easy blue terrain
  • Change turns to slow down around other people
  • Keep arms out to the side & in front slightly to help balance
  • Glide backwards in a wedge on a beginner run
  • Start to learn park safety etiquette & ski over a box
